Painting after painting: In the works of Svenja Deininger, the diverse problems and crises of art in the age of technical images are reflected and made productive as a creative impulse. Deininger questions materials, techniques and apodictic demands for objectivity and abstraction and wins aesthetic solutions from these conflict situations. Her aim is not to create a false artistic harmony, but to understand the dissonances that go hand in hand with contemporary painting as an integral part of her work. Svenja Deininger often uses different primers that create surface tension in the picture and influence the coloring - a modular approach in which the coloristic is used atmospherically to either create balance or create a counterweight. Despite its explicitly non-narrative character, Svenja Deininger's painting seems to open up mysterious pictorial spaces. Sometimes one thinks, as with Edward Hopper, that one is looking through a window at a landscape flooded with light, occasionally the viewer is confronted with the illusion of spatial depth due to the harsh contrasting of light and dark tones and the combination of geometric patterns. “I follow different painting styles in one picture that exist side by side. Some of them have not been completed, I destroy their results again until they suddenly connect again. ”
Svenja Deininger, Press text Kunsthalle Wien for the exhibition“ Lives and works in Vienna III ”, 2010
